Administrative Assistant to the Superintendent of Employee Services

Work Location: OCDSB Administration Building, 133 Greenbank Road, Nepean

Nature of Position: 100% Regular, Monday - Friday, 35 hours per week

Salary range: $64,114 to $75,477 per annum (Union Exempt, Level 4)

The Administrative Assistant provides confidential and professional administrative support to a member of the district’s senior management, which includes Superintendents, Executive Officer, Associate Director and the Office of the Director of Education.

The Assistant undertakes a broad range of administrative activities to ensure the effective day to

day operations of the office, including coordinating work flow, providing updates on all current

and emerging issues of importance; maintaining schedules and calendaring system; gathering

data from various sources, preparing correspondence, reports and agendas; coordinating

meetings and taking minutes; communicating with a variety of contacts, both internal and

external on a daily basis; and performs other administrative functions.
